Vivy: Fluorite Eye's Song
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 13
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Action, Psychological, Drama, Time Travel
Vivy: Fluorite Eye's Song is a visually striking anime that follows Vivy, the first autonomous singing AI, who is tasked with preventing a future war between AIs and humans. Sent back 100 years into the past, she must alter the course of events using her voice and strength. This emotional journey combines action-packed sequences with deep philosophical questions about humanity and purpose.

Ergo Proxy
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 23
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Mystery, Psychological, Cyberpunk, Thriller
Ergo Proxy is a hauntingly atmospheric anime set in a domed city where humans and androids coexist under strict governance. As detective Re-L Mayer investigates a series of bizarre murders linked to sentient robots, she uncovers truths about society, identity, and existence. The series delves deep into psychological and philosophical questions, wrapped in a noir-style narrative and dystopian backdrop.

Psycho-Pass
- Season: 3
- Episodes: 41 + 3 movies
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Crime, Action, Psychological, Dystopian
Psycho-Pass explores a chilling future where a government AI system monitors mental states to judge criminal potential. Akane Tsunemori joins the Public Safety Bureau to uphold justice while questioning the morality of the Sibyl System. As the line between law and freedom blurs, she must decide where she stands. This anime is rich with action, suspense, and ethical dilemmas.

Casshern Sins
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 24
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Action, Drama, Post-Apocalyptic, Psychological
Casshern Sins follows a mysterious warrior in a ruined world where humans and robots face extinction. Casshern, cursed with immortality, searches for answers about his past and the planet’s collapse. Each episode offers introspective storytelling, layered emotions, and philosophical insights. It’s a beautifully bleak series that questions the meaning of life and death through haunting landscapes and personal tragedy.

No.6
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 11
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Drama, Mystery, Dystopian, Action
No.6 tells the story of Shion, a privileged boy living in an idealistic city, who befriends Nezumi, a fugitive from the outside slums. As Shion uncovers the sinister truth behind No.6’s utopia, he must decide between loyalty to the system and standing up for humanity. Their bond is tested through conspiracies, sacrifices, and revelations that reshape their world.

86 (Eighty-Six)
- Season: 2
- Episodes: 23
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Mecha, Drama, Military, Tragedy
86 (Eighty-Six) uncovers the truth behind a war fought by drones, which are actually piloted by humans from a marginalized group. Major Lena commands a squad from the comfort of the city, while the pilots live and die in secrecy. As they forge connections, questions of morality, racism, and war ethics unravel in this gripping military drama with futuristic themes.

Sidonia no Kishi
- Season: 2
- Episodes: 24 + 1 movie
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Mecha, Action, Space, Military
Sidonia no Kishi (Knights of Sidonia) follows Nagate Tanikaze, a pilot aboard the spaceship Sidonia, humanity’s last refuge after Earth’s destruction. As the Gauna aliens threaten their survival, Nagate joins the elite mecha squad to protect the colony. The series blends high-stakes combat with themes of genetics, identity, and human evolution in a hostile universe.

Blame!
- Season: Movie
- Episodes: 1
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Cyberpunk, Action, Dystopian, AI
Blame! portrays a far-future Earth consumed by endless cityscapes, controlled by rogue AI. Killy, a silent wanderer, searches for the Net Terminal Gene to restore order. This anime is visually immersive, minimal in dialogue, and loaded with atmosphere. It paints a world that feels eerily lifeless and hopeless, reflecting themes of isolation, control, and perseverance against technological decay.

A.I.C.O. Incarnation
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 12
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Action, Mystery, Biotechnology, Drama
A.I.C.O. Incarnation follows Aiko, a teenage girl who learns her body is linked to a catastrophic biotech event called the Burst. To save humanity and herself, she embarks on a dangerous mission to the epicenter with a group of specialists. The series blends genetic intrigue, identity crisis, and adrenaline-pumping action in a unique sci-fi setting.

God Eater
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 13
- Genre: Action, Sci-Fi, Post-Apocalyptic, Supernatural, Drama
God Eater is set in a devastated world where monstrous beings called Aragami have wiped out most of humanity. Special fighters known as God Eaters wield unique weapons fused with Aragami cells to combat the threat. The anime boasts stunning visuals, emotional flashbacks, and explosive battles that highlight human resilience and the price of survival.

Texhnolyze
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 22
- Genre: Cyberpunk, Psychological, Sci-Fi, Drama, Dystopian
Texhnolyze follows Ichise, a prizefighter in the underground city of Lux, who loses limbs and becomes part of a larger cybernetic experiment. The story dives deep into political strife, human consciousness, and nihilistic futures. Minimal dialogue and haunting imagery make this anime a powerful exploration of identity, control, and entropy in a collapsing world.

Appleseed
- Format: Movie (2004) + Series (Appleseed XIII)
- Episodes: 13 (Series)
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Mecha, Action, Cyberpunk, Military
Appleseed, also known as Appleseed XIII, tells the story of Deunan and Briareos, elite soldiers in a post-apocalyptic Earth. In the utopian city of Olympus, humans and bioroids coexist under a fragile system. The anime tackles themes of control, surveillance, and human evolution through breathtaking visuals and dynamic mecha warfare.

Expelled from Paradise
- Format: Movie
- Episodes: 1
- Genre: Sci-Fi, Mecha, Action, Cyberpunk, Post-Apocalyptic
Expelled from Paradise follows Angela Balzac, an agent from a digital utopia, as she's sent to the Earth's surface to hunt a hacker disrupting their system. What she finds challenges her beliefs about freedom, identity, and existence. The film combines stunning CG animation with philosophical depth and thrilling action set in a world recovering from catastrophe.

Kokkoku
- Season: 1
- Episodes: 12
- Genre: Supernatural, Thriller, Mystery, Drama, Psychological
Kokkoku revolves around a mysterious ability to stop time, known as the Stasis. When Juri's family is threatened, she uses this power to enter a hidden world where strange creatures and rival factions operate. The story weaves family bonds, time manipulation, and mind-bending revelations into a suspenseful and unpredictable anime experience.
